Marquis with Mandolin by Roullet

Description

A bisque-head man with blue glass eyes, closed mouth, portrait like expression, blonde mohair wig, carton torso and legs, metal hands, is standing on flat base, holding a wooden mandolin with inlay design. He is wearing pale green silk Marquis costume with gold embroidery, gilt metallic trim, matching hat with silk ribbons, shoes. Movements: he turns head from side to side and nods; he strums the mandolin. By Jean Roullet, France, circa 1880. 22" (56 cm). Three movements. One tune.
